When it comes to musical theater auditions, you need to come prepared. For you, this can include having your book ready, knowing your sides, and being prepared to dance and/or sing at a moment's notice. Ask acting coach and Backstage Expert Philip Hernández, however, and he'll tell you that there's one more thing that you need to do in order to wow any casting director you ever audition for: be prepared to tell a story!
Watch Philip in the video above as he explains exactly what that means and how you could apply it to your next audition.
